When selecting SS mesh screens, it is essential to consider factors such as wire diameter, mesh size, and the specific application requirements. A finer mesh size allows for better filtration, but it may also result in increased resistance and reduced flow rates. Therefore, understanding the balance between filtration efficiency and flow dynamics is crucial. For example, a study by the Institute of Chemical Engineers highlighted that optimizing mesh specifications could enhance flow rates by up to 20% while maintaining effective filtration.
Tips: Always consult with filtration specialists to determine the best mesh specifications for your needs. Additionally, regular maintenance and cleaning of SS mesh screens are vital to sustaining their performance and efficiency. It is advisable to perform routine inspections to ensure that the screens are not clogged, as this can severely impact filtration outcomes.

When it comes to industrial applications, the maintenance and cleaning of equipment are critical factors that can significantly affect operational efficiency. SS mesh screens, known for their robust structure and versatility, provide a noteworthy advantage in this regard. Their design inherently facilitates easy access and routine cleaning, which is essential for preventing contamination and ensuring optimal performance. Unlike traditional filtration systems, SS mesh screens can be quickly removed for maintenance, minimizing downtime and enhancing productivity.
Additionally, the smooth surface and corrosion-resistant properties of stainless steel make SS mesh screens particularly easy to clean. They can be efficiently washed with simple detergents and water or even subjected to high-pressure cleaning methods without fear of damage. This not only extends the lifespan of the screens but also reduces the need for harsh chemicals that can pose safety risks and environmental concerns. As a result, industries can maintain higher hygiene standards while also benefiting from reduced labor costs associated with maintenance efforts.
Stainless steel mesh screens are increasingly popular in various industrial applications due to their inherent resistance to corrosion and chemical damage. This key attribute makes them exceptionally valuable in environments where exposure to aggressive substances is commonplace. Unlike aluminum or carbon steel options, stainless steel retains its structural integrity and performance levels when subjected to harsh conditions, ensuring longevity and reducing the need for frequent replacements.
Moreover, the resistance to chemical damage is particularly critical. In industries such as pharmaceuticals, food processing, and wastewater treatment, failure of screening materials can lead to contamination and production downtime. Stainless steel mesh screens provide a reliable barrier that can withstand caustic chemicals, acids, and solvents, thereby ensuring that processes run smoothly without compromise. This resilience not only enhances efficiency but also contributes to maintaining the safety and quality standards required in these sectors. Overall, the robustness of stainless steel against corrosion and chemical degradation positions it as a superior choice for industrial applications demanding durability and reliability.
